Vancouver Giants name leadership group The Vancouver Giants have announced their leadership group for the 2020-21 season. Alex Kannok Leipert is back for his second season as captain, while fellow over-agers Tristen Nielsen and Eric Florchuk will serve as alternates. Looking back at the 2006 NHL Draft Class from the WHL
With the NHL Entry Draft set to return to Vancouver for the first time since 2006, we thought it would be fun to look back at the 2006 NHL Entry Draft and how the WHL class has fared since then.
